OpenJDK 8_322版本Linux解压安装指南

版权申诉
5星 · 超过95%的资源 12 下载量 13 浏览量 更新于2024-11-08 收藏 98.29MB GZ 举报
资源摘要信息:"OpenJDK 8_322 Linux解压安装版是Java开发工具包(JDK)的开源实现版本,适用于Linux操作系统平台。该版本的更新日期是2022年2月,其版本号为8u322-b06。OpenJDK 8是Java SE 8的开源版本,包含了Java编程语言的标准实现,提供了一个完整的Java开发和运行环境。OpenJDK 8_322版本在开源社区的支持下不断修复了之前的漏洞,并且包含了最新的性能改进和功能更新。 OpenJDK全称是Open Java Development Kit,是Java Platform, Standard Edition (Java SE) 的开源实现。它是Java程序开发和运行的基础,为开发者提供了编写、编译、调试和运行Java程序所需的一切。OpenJDK是商业版JDK的替代品,通常用于开源项目和免费使用场景。 OpenJDK 8版本的亮点包括: 1. Lambda表达式:Java 8最大的特性之一就是Lambda表达式,它允许开发者使用函数式编程的方式编写Java代码,这大大简化了Java编程,并且使得代码更加简洁和易于阅读。Lambda表达式支持Java中的函数式接口,可以视为简洁的实现方式。 2. Stream API:伴随Lambda表达式一同出现的Stream API,为处理集合和数组提供了一种全新的处理方式,支持数据的并行处理,提高了数据处理的效率和性能。 3. 接口的默认方法和静态方法:Java 8允许在接口中添加默认方法和静态方法,这为扩展接口提供了更多的灵活性。 4. Java Time API:Java 8引入了全新的日期和时间API,称为java.time包。这个新的API改进了旧版日期时间处理的不足,提供了更好的日期时间处理能力。 5. 新的JVM特性:Java 8包括许多新的JVM特性,如G1垃圾收集器的进一步优化,以及其他性能改进。 安装OpenJDK 8_322 Linux解压安装版的步骤一般包括: 1. 从官方网站或者其他可信的源下载OpenJDK 8_322的压缩包。 2. 解压下载的压缩包到指定的目录,例如:`tar -xvf jdk-8u322-linux-x64.tar.gz`。 3. 将解压后的JDK目录下的`bin`文件夹添加到系统的PATH环境变量中,这样可以在命令行中直接使用`java`和`javac`等命令。 4. 可能还需要设置JAVA_HOME环境变量,指向JDK的安装目录。 5. 验证安装是否成功,通过运行`java -version`和`javac -version`命令来检查是否输出了正确的版本信息。 OpenJDK在企业和开发社区中广泛使用,其开源特性和活跃的社区支持保证了它能够不断进化,及时满足开发者的需要。无论是对于开发人员还是企业级用户,OpenJDK都是构建Java应用的基础。"